@andresloft
@andresloft Жыл бұрын
It is pretty tranquil traveling along the river, and chill talking and hanging out with the locals. To see more wildlife, you’ll have better chance if it’s during the dawn or dusk, or maybe at night. Midday the animals would tend to rest because it’s rather hot. It’s always good to get a good guide, just let them know what you want to see or experience and the guide will their best. If you want to see crocs, that’s probably night tour, same goes for fireflies…. If you want to see wild elephants, that’s probably at dawn. If you want to see wild tiger, well, it’s gonna be rare and the guide probably show you footages or images taken recently, but nonetheless, at Taman Negara, there are spots among the canopies where u can hear tigers passing by. It’s rare, and you may be feeding mosquitoes instead for such experience.

@alleymittanderson5799
@alleymittanderson5799 Жыл бұрын
Kuala Tahan National Park is one of my fav national park. I always come here at least once a year spending my whole 7days exploring. Sometime i am hiking from here to the Peak of Mount Tahan 9th highest mountain in Malaysia and highest in Peninsular Malaysia. My favourite stay there is Danz campsite and a small villa few hundred meter from the school. In our old days we love to go to Telinga cave but then its closed forever because of safety reason. If the river are shallow during dry season there is a beach volley ball games for every evening at the small sandy island at the river. Foods at the floating restaurant also good 😁 there is a direct shuttle from Kuala Tahan to Kuala Lumpur so its easy for traveller, istead of bus hopping from Kuantan.

@turgonmiyantur5974
@turgonmiyantur5974 Жыл бұрын
Hi Ken. Actually, the National Park is renowned for the highest mountain in the Peninsula, called the Gunung Tahan. Many avid and intrepid local groups would attempt it and its probably the toughest 4-7 days camping trip 'in the wild' and 'endless river crossing' plus lots of sweats and rain and some parts are rocky too! The leeches are probably the last thing that will accompany these souls. Haha... Yes, the 'rimba' (forest) is wild, and its beauty is surreal when the clouds kick in. Lush greenery canopies, distinct wildlife and vegetation, and the unknown truly mesmerise many! @kakisport
@kakisport Жыл бұрын
Usually Malaysians will go to such places during the school holidays in January, March, June, August and December. On weekends usually people like to go back to their hometowns and people from kampungs will go to visit cities like KL just for a change of scenery. Anyway, most tourists areas in Malaysia especially those in jungle areas or island will be closed to tourists in the month of November to January because of the monsoon season
